python
人工神经元网络包括?
一、人工神经元网络包括?
人工神经网络主要架构是由神经元、层和网络三个部分组成。整个人工神经网络包含一系列基本的神经元、通过权重相互连接。
神经元是人工神经网络最基本的单元。单元以层的方式组,每一层的每个神经元和前一层、后一层的神经元连接,共分为输入层、输出层和隐藏层,三层连接形成一个神经网络。
输入层只从外部环境接收信息,是由输入单元组成,而这些输入单元可接收样本中各种不同的特征信息。该层的每个神经元相当于自变量,不完成任何计算,只为下一层传递信息;隐藏层介于输入层和输出层之间,这些层完全用于分析,其函数联系输入层变量和输出层变量,使其更配适数据。而最后,输出层生成最终结果,每个输出单元会对应到某一种特定的分类,为网络送给外部系统的结果值,,整个网络由调整链接强度的程序来达成学习的目的。
假如输出单元的输出值和所预期的值相同,那么连接到此输出单元的链接强度则不被改变。但如果应该输出1的单元却输出0,那么连接到这个单元的链接强度则会被加强。相反,如果应该输出0却输出1,那么连接到此输出单元的链接强度则会被降低。简单地说,达成收敛的效果是这个学习程序的主要目标。目前尚没有统一的标准方法可以计算人工神经网络的最佳层数。
二、神经元网络算法原理?
逻辑性的思维是指根据逻辑规则进行推理的过程;它先将信息化成概念,并用符号表示,然后,根据符号运算按串行模式进行逻辑推理;这一过程可以写成串行的指令,让计算机执行。然而,直观性的思维是将分布式存储的信息综合起来,结果是忽然间产生的想法或解决问题的办法。
这种思维方式的根本之点在于以下两点:
1.信息是通过神经元上的兴奋模式分布存储在网络上;
2.信息处理是通过神经元之间同时相互作用的动态过程来完成的。
三、什么是单神经元网络?
单神经元网络(Single Neuron Network)是一种最简单的人工神经网络(Artificial Neural Network,ANN)结构,仅包含一个神经元。尽管它非常简单,但这种网络结构在某些情况下仍具有一定的应用价值。
神经元是神经网络的基本计算单元,它接收多个输入信号,并产生一个输出信号。在单神经元网络中,神经元的输入信号通常通过连接权重与输入信号相乘,然后将乘积相加。最后,将相加结果传递给激活函数,生成神经元的输出信号。
单神经元网络的数学表示如下:
y = f(w1*x1 + w2*x2 + ... + wn*xn)
其中:
- y 是神经元的输出信号
- f 是激活函数(如Sigmoid、ReLU等)
- wi 是输入信号xi的连接权重
- xi 是第i个输入信号
- n 是输入信号的数量
在实际应用中,单神经元网络常用于解决简单的线性可分问题(linearly separable problems),如二元分类(Binary Classification)任务。然而,由于其结构过于简单,单神经元网络在处理复杂的非线性问题时表现不佳。在多数实际应用中,人们通常使用更复杂的神经网络结构(如多层感知器、卷积神经网络等)来解决更复杂的问题。
四、神经元网络算法优缺点?
1.优点:
(1)具有自学习功能。例如实现图像识别时,只在先把许多不同的图像样板和对应的应识别的结果输入人工神经网络,网络就会通过自学习功能,慢慢学会识别类似的图像。自学习功能对于预测有特别重要的意义。预期未来的人工神经网络计算机将为人类提供经济预测、市场预测、效益预测,其应用前途是很远大的。
(2)具有联想存储功能。用人工神经网络的反馈网络就可以实现这种联想。
(3)具有高速寻找优化解的能力。寻找一个复杂问题的优化解,往往需要很大的计算量,利用一个针对某问题而设计的反馈型人工神经网络,发挥计算机的高速运算能力,可能很快找到优化解。
2.缺点:
(1)最严重的问题是没能力来解释自己的推理过程和推理依据。
(2)不能向用户提出必要的询问,而且当数据不充分的时候,神经网络就无法进行工作。
(3)把一切问题的特征都变为数字,把一切推理都变为数值计算,其结果势必是丢失信息。
(4)理论和学习算法还有待于进一步完善和提高。
五、人工神经元网络又叫什么?
人工神经元网络实际上是一个采用物理可实现的系统来模仿人脑神经。
六、神经元网络是什么意思?
神经元网络是指由神经元形成的网络,这些神经元有助于以数学方式处理信号,并根据输入的数据和权重参数,生成输出结果。
它与人类大脑中的神经元相似,但不同的是,神经元网络可以根据对数据分析的结果来做出反应,而不是依靠感官信息。
神经元网络可以用来解决复杂的问题,如语音识别、图像分类以及自然语言处理。
它们也可以用于强化学习,即通过反馈的方式学习环境中的模式,并在未来做出更好的决定。
七、神经元网络专家系统
神经元网络专家系统是一种基于人工智能的计算机系统,它模仿人类神经元之间相互连接的方式,用于解决复杂的问题和进行智能决策。这种系统结合了神经网络和专家系统的特点,可以通过训练和学习不断优化自身的性能,成为某一特定领域的专家。
神经元网络
神经元网络是指由大量神经元相互连接而成的网络结构,类似于人类的大脑神经网络。每个神经元都有多个输入和一个输出,当输入达到一定阈值时,神经元会激活并将信号传递给下一层神经元。通过调整连接的权重和阈值,神经元网络可以学习和记忆各种模式,并具有一定的智能。
专家系统
专家系统是一种基于专家知识和推理机制的人工智能系统,可以模拟人类专家在特定领域内进行推理和决策的能力。专家系统通过建立知识库、规则库和推理引擎来实现问题求解,能够快速准确地给出结论和建议。
神经元网络专家系统的优势
神经元网络专家系统结合了神经网络和专家系统的优势,具有以下几个显著优势:
- 学习能力强:神经元网络可以通过大量数据的训练不断优化自身的性能,学习各种模式和规律,具有较强的自适应能力;
- 推理效率高:专家系统可以通过建立规则库和知识库来进行问题求解,结合神经网络的并行计算能力,能够快速有效地进行推理;
- 专业领域应用广泛:神经元网络专家系统可以在医疗诊断、金融风险评估、工业控制等领域发挥重要作用,为决策提供科学依据。
神经元网络专家系统的应用
神经元网络专家系统在各个领域都有广泛应用,以下是一些典型的应用案例:
医疗诊断
神经元网络专家系统可以利用患者的临床数据和医学知识,辅助医生进行疾病诊断和治疗方案制定。通过分析患者的病历和检查结果,系统可以帮助医生快速做出准确的诊断,提高治疗效果。
金融风险评估
在金融领域,神经元网络专家系统可以通过分析市场数据和风险因素,帮助金融机构识别风险,进行资产配置和投资决策。系统可以快速准确地评估风险,提高投资回报率。
工业控制
在工业生产过程中,神经元网络专家系统可以监控设备运行状态,预测故障风险,优化生产计划,提高生产效率和产品质量。系统可以实现智能化的生产管理,降低生产成本。
结语
神经元网络专家系统是人工智能技术的重要应用之一,具有广阔的发展前景和应用价值。随着技术不断创新和进步,神经元网络专家系统将在更多领域中发挥重要作用,为人类生产生活带来更多便利和效益。
八、python?
Python是一种跨平台的计算机程序设计语言。 是一个高层次的结合了解释性、编译性、互动性和面向对象的脚本语言。最初被设计用于编写自动化脚本(shell),随着版本的不断更新和语言新功能的添加,越多被用于独立的、大型项目的开发。
它还有一个很惊人的中文名,叫蟒蛇。
九、python和python的区别?
python和python这2个是一样的,并没有区别。
很显然,两个一样的物品或者内容并不存在不同,提问的第一个元素与第二个元素是一模一样,本质上讲就是一个东西、一件事情。
建议把前后两个要做对比的元素描述清楚,比如python2.X和Python3.X有什么区别,才能正确结论。
十、python为什么叫python?
自从20世纪90年代初Python语言诞生至今,它已被逐渐广泛应用于系统管理任务的处理和Web编程。
Python的创始人为荷兰人吉多·范罗苏姆 [4] (Guido van Rossum)。1989年圣诞节期间,在阿姆斯特丹,Guido为了打发圣诞节的无趣,决心开发一个新的脚本解释程序,作为ABC 语言的一种继承。之所以选中Python(大蟒蛇的意思)作为该编程语言的名字,是取自英国20世纪70年代首播的电视喜剧《蒙提.派森的飞行马戏团》(Monty Python's Flying Circus)。
热点信息
-
在Python中,要查看函数的用法,可以使用以下方法: 1. 使用内置函数help():在Python交互式环境中,可以直接输入help(函数名)来获取函数的帮助文档。例如,...
-
一、java 连接数据库 在当今信息时代,Java 是一种广泛应用的编程语言,尤其在与数据库进行交互的过程中发挥着重要作用。无论是在企业级应用开发还是...
-
一、idea连接mysql数据库 php connect_error) { die("连接失败: " . $conn->connect_error);}echo "成功连接到MySQL数据库!";// 关闭连接$conn->close();?> 二、idea连接mysql数据库连...
-
要在Python中安装modbus-tk库,您可以按照以下步骤进行操作: 1. 确保您已经安装了Python解释器。您可以从Python官方网站(https://www.python.org)下载和安装最新版本...